ITU Regional Development Forum and the Second Africa Preparatory Meeting (APM) for the 2026 ITU Plenipotentiary Conference (PP-26).

Monday 25 May 2026 - Saturday 30 May 2026

Africa | Victoria Falls, Zimbabwe | In Person

Event Description

The ITU Regional Development Forum for Africa 2026 (RDF-AFR) takes place from 25 to 26 May in Victoria Falls, Zimbabwe. It is followed from 27 to 29 May by the Second Africa Preparatory Meeting (APM) for the 2026 ITU Plenipotentiary Conference (PP-26). Both events are hosted by the Postal and Telecommunications Regulatory Authority of Zimbabwe (POTRAZ). Under the theme Universal, meaningful, and affordable connectivity for an inclusive and sustainable digital future, the Regional Development Forum for Africa serves as a platform for ITU and its stakeholders, including Member States, Sector Members, Associates and Academia, regional organizations, development partners and financial institutions, to discuss the newly adopted regional initiatives for Africa and exchange views on achieving meaningful connectivity and sustainable digital transformation in the region. RDF-AFR features Partner2Connect matchmaking sessions and provides an opportunity to match specific country and regional needs with potential partners’ interests to advance digital development.
